## Abstract

The anticancer potential of Vallisneria spiralis Linnaeus (Vallisneria spiralis L.) for human
breast cancer management is of interest. In vitro shows that increasing concentrations of Vallisneria spiralis
silver nanoparticles (AgNPs) and iron oxide nanoparticles (IONPs) resulted in greater cytotoxicity against MCF-7 breast cancer cells.
The antioxidant potential of Vallisneria spiralis L. was assessed using 2-diphenyl-1-picryl-hydroxyl (DPPH) radical
scavenging assay. Further molecular docking analysis of phytocompounds from Vallisneria spiralis L. with the target
protein (PDB ID: 3CZH) shows optimal binding features. Thus, cytotoxicity analysis of Vallisneria spiralis for breast
cancer with molecular docking of its phytochemicals and a target protein 3CZH is reported for further consideration.
